Create Custom Post Type In WordPress Without Plugin

However, the identical organization doesn’t essentially make sense for customized submit types. Your weblog posts could be about your “Life,” your “Thoughts” or your “Dreams.” These are clearly not appropriate for merchandise. Combining custom submit sorts and custom fields will allow you to create extra complete content material with further details about your subject. Remember above we created “offers” as taxonomy for the customized posts classes for presents.

create custom post type in wordpress without plugin

Choose a template you have created in one of the previous steps and assign it to the page. You want to just create a file in the theme folder and add the next line on top of that file. But I would advocate to you click on on that auto-populate hyperlink so it’ll fill routinely accordingly. These fields are used within the WordPress interface to manage the content. Next elective subject about auto-populate label name in the additional fields. It means whenever you click on the hyperlink it’ll auto-fill the fields underneath the Additional Label section using the Plural and Singular label.

Creating A Customized Template Devoted To Custom Post Varieties

Similarly, if you upload an image or another attachment, WordPress makes use of the Attachment submit kind to display it individually. As identical as the above class creation here we going to create for tags. Use the under function to get the tags option in your created Custom Post Type. If you want to change format of page or any other code inside single-offers.php you can do in accordance with your requirement and website design. When WordPress was designed the initial idea was to have posts and pages that could be used to publish blog posts and pages to publish static content that might not change often. Once you’ve added some merchandise, you’ll need to have the power to show these on the entrance finish of your website.

It will add more options like help for revisions, highlighted picture, customized fields, and tons of more. WordPress knows what post type each post is as a result of it’s going to have a price within the post_type field within the wp_posts table. That value will correspond to the name of the post sort. So whenever you add a brand new blog post, WordPress will add a submit to the wp_posts desk, with the post_type of “post”. In this article, I’ll show you exactly how WordPress customized publish types work.

What Can Be Created With The Custom Post Types Plugin?

Want to create custom submit sort in WordPress with out plugin?? If you want to edit the means in which that the customized publish type archive is output, then you’ll find a way to create a template file in your custom post type archive. WordPress will use the template hierarchy to identify which template file in your theme to make use of to show the customized post kind archive. When you register your custom post type, you can choose to assign any current taxonomy or taxonomies to it.

  • With the set up of WordPress, we only get three built-in content material types on the back finish.
  • There are a number of methods in which you can print a CPT on the entrance end.
  • For example, in a jobs listing web site, you might use custom fields to store the situation, wage, and dealing hours for a emptiness.

Single posts created utilizing a custom post type may even be shown utilizing the first relevant template file that’s found within the template hierarchy. The best approach to create this file is by making a reproduction of the archive.php file in your theme. Rename it and edit it so it shows your publish kind archive the best way you wish to. Adding a menu item in the WordPress customizerSelect your publish kind from the options that seem and click on on not he downwards arrow to the right of its name. This will show al record that features each of the posts you’ve added, plus an choice which in my case known as All Books. The first option you might have is to create an archive web page of all of the posts in your customized publish sort archive.

Get Photographs From WordPress Posts And Display As WordPress Post Thumbnail

I’ll compare them to the publish varieties you could be extra familiar with, train you tips on how to create them, and show you how to use theme template recordsdata to display them in your site. Using the same process, you can create as many custom post types as you need. However, to avoid any confusion, make certain you only create custom submit varieties when you can’t use the present post types for publishing your content material.

create custom post type in wordpress without plugin

This is an easy box which only incorporates the worth, so we now have created a label and an input to manage it. A nonce field can additionally be current, which provides security to the info submission. As I mentioned there are a lot of issues you can modify when creating a submit sort. I recommend looking on the arguments list within the Codex for a full description of each option and the possible values.

Is The Custom Publish Varieties Plugin Suitable With My Theme Builder?

Let’s begin creating customized post varieties using two methods with plugins and with out plugins. WordPress provides a function called register_post_type() which you utilize to create your customized submit type. You add the function to your theme’s functions file or to a plugin you create particularly, and then fire it via the init hook in WordPress. The correct approach to display customized post type knowledge is by utilizing customized templates for each of the custom post types. Here we will create a template which displays all the Movie Reviews entered using the Movie Review Custom Post Type. Notice that you could change the messages for all customized submit sorts using this single perform.